Early Beginnings and Initial Breakthroughs

Although the concept of hybrid technology has been around since the early 20th century, it wasn't until the 1990s that it gained traction as a solution to rising fuel costs and environmental concerns. The Toyota Prius, introduced in 1997, marked the beginning of the modern hybrid era, offering a practical alternative to gasoline-only vehicles. This initial breakthrough laid the groundwork for further advancements in the coming years.

Mid-2000s: Growth and Expansion

The early 2000s saw an explosion of hybrid vehicle models, with major automotive manufacturers like Honda, Ford, and BMW entering the market. This period was characterized by improvements in battery technology, increased fuel efficiency, and the integration of hybrid technology into various vehicle types, from sedans to SUVs. The mid-2000s also witnessed the establishment of government incentives and regulations aimed at promoting hybrid and electric vehicles to reduce carbon emissions and improve air quality.

Recent Developments and Future Prospects

Recent years have seen the automotive industry make significant strides towards fully integrating hybrid technology into mainstream vehicles. Advancements in regenerative braking, electric motor technology, and battery storage capacity have led to vehicles that are not only more efficient but also more accessible to a broader consumer base. The future looks promising as the industry continues to focus on reducing emissions and enhancing the driving experience in hybrid vehicles.

Frequently Asked Questions

Q1: What was the first commercial hybrid car?
The Toyota Prius, launched in 1997, is widely recognized as the first mass-produced hybrid car.

Q2: How has hybrid technology evolved since its inception?
Since its inception, hybrid technology has seen improvements in battery efficiency, electric motor performance, and overall vehicle design, making hybrid vehicles more efficient and cost-effective.

Q3: Which car manufacturers are leading the charge in hybrid technology?
Toyota, Honda, BMW, and Ford are among the leading manufacturers in the development and production of hybrid vehicles.

Q4: How does hybrid technology contribute to environmental sustainability?
Hybrid technology reduces reliance on fossil fuels, decreases greenhouse gas emissions, and promotes the use of renewable energy sources, contributing significantly to environmental sustainability.

Q5: What advancements can we expect to see in the future of hybrid technology?
Future advancements in hybrid technology include improvements in battery technology, increased electric-only driving ranges, and more efficient powertrains to enhance performance and reduce emissions.
